Net Price by Family Income
Average net price for students receiving Title IV federal financial aid (2022-23)
$0 - $30,000
$15,779
$30,001 - $48,000
$19,129
$48,001 - $75,000
$20,165
$75,001 - $110,000
$21,629
Over $110,000
$26,575
Financial Aid Overview
For first-time, full-time undergraduate students (2022-23)
Students Receiving Any Financial Aid
234 of 235 students
Grants & Scholarships
Recipients
234 (100%)
Average Award
$20,319
Federal Pell Grants
Recipients
43 (18%)
Average Award
$4,111
Aid by Source
State & Local Grants
42 recipients (18%)
$3,654 avg
Institutional Grants
234 recipients (100%)
$18,846 avg
Student Loans
Federal student loan data for all undergraduates (2022-23)
Total Borrowers
859
58% of students
Average Loan Amount
$6,950
